    The Steenbras Power Station, also Steenbras Hydro Pump Station, is a 180 MW pumped-storage hydroelectric power station commissioned in 1979 in South Africa.The power station sits between the Steenbras Upper Dam and a small lower reservoir on the mountainside below. [1]
